The Science of Long-Lasting Lip Color
Understanding the science behind lip color longevity can help you make better choices when it comes to products and application techniques. Lip products contain a combination of waxes, oils, and pigments, each affecting how long the color stays on. For example, matte lipsticks and stains typically have higher wax and pigment content, making them stick longer to your lips. Glosses, which have more oil, tend to fade faster. By recognizing these factors, you can better select products designed for extended wear.
Prepping Your Lips for Lasting Color
Preparation is key to achieving long-lasting lip color. A well-prepared lip surface helps the color adhere better and prevents it from fading or feathering prematurely. Here’s how to start:
Step 1: Exfoliate Your Lips
Exfoliation removes dead skin cells that can make lip color look uneven and fade quickly. A lip scrub or a soft toothbrush works well for this. Gently rub your lips in circular motions, then rinse and apply a hydrating balm. Regular exfoliation also ensures a smooth surface for lip products.
Step 2: Moisturize with a Lip Balm
After exfoliating, it’s essential to hydrate your lips. Choose a balm with nourishing ingredients like shea butter or vitamin E to keep lips soft. Make sure the balm absorbs fully before moving to the next step. This creates a balanced, moisturized base for your lip color.
Step 3: Prime Your Lips
Similar to priming your face, priming your lips can enhance color longevity. Apply a lip primer or a bit of concealer over your lips. Priming fills in fine lines and creates a barrier that helps prevent color bleeding or fading.
Choosing Long-Lasting Lip Products
Not all lip products are made equal when it comes to staying power. Opt for those formulated for durability, like matte lipsticks, lip stains, and liquid formulas. Here are some of the best options:
Matte Lipsticks
Matte lipsticks have long-lasting, intense color due to their low oil content. They adhere well to the lips, making them less likely to fade. While matte formulas can be drying, prepping your lips with balm helps keep them comfortable.
Lip Stains
Lip stains create a semi-permanent color that can last through meals and drinks. These formulas sink into your lips, giving a natural, lightweight feel. For added hydration, pair lip stains with a gloss or balm.
Liquid Lipsticks

Application Techniques for Long-Lasting Lip Color
Applying your lip color correctly can significantly extend its wear. These application techniques will help your lip color last longer:
Use a Lip Liner
Lip liner is crucial for creating a defined edge and preventing color feathering. Select a shade close to your lipstick, and line your lips, filling them in entirely for a color base.
Layer Your Lip Color
For extended wear, apply lipstick in layers. Start with a thin coat, blot with a tissue, and reapply. This technique sets the color and minimizes fading.
Set with Powder
Lightly set your lip color by placing a tissue over your lips and dusting translucent powder over it. This extra step locks in the color and reduces smudging, making it perfect for all-day wear.
Setting Your Lip Color
Adding a setting step to your routine can make a significant difference in the wear time of your lip color. Consider the following methods to ensure a long-lasting finish:
Setting Spray
Using a makeup setting spray over your lips and face is another effective way to lock in color. Many setting sprays are formulated to hold makeup in place for hours, helping to maintain vibrant lip color even after eating or drinking. Translucent Powder
If you don’t have a setting spray, translucent powder works well too. Apply a thin tissue over your lips, then gently press powder over it. This trick creates a barrier that prevents color transfer and prolongs wear time.
Maintaining Your Lip Color Throughout the Day
Even with all the right techniques, some maintenance may be necessary. Here are ways to keep your lip color fresh:
Carry a Lip Balm
If you’re wearing a matte or stain formula, applying a clear balm or gloss can help revive the color while keeping your lips hydrated. Avoid glosses with high oil content, as they may break down the color underneath.
Avoid Oily Foods
Oils are the biggest enemy of long-lasting lip color. To keep your lip color intact, try to avoid oily foods or eat carefully. Drinking through a straw can also help preserve your lip color when consuming beverages.
Reapply Sparingly
If you need to touch up, do so sparingly to avoid a caked-on look. Dab on a thin layer of product, blot, and reapply only if necessary. This approach keeps your lip color looking fresh without excess buildup.
